What is the "Perfect" Body?
In computer class we transformed our faces on to a someone else's face. We did this to show how "fake" some pictures are in magazines and books. For me I used a picture of Jessica Simpson since we look somewhat alike me. I do not have perfect skin, makeup, or hair on a daily bases. This assignment has changed my view on magazine pictures because I used to think they were some what real but in reality they aren't at all. They change what they really look like completely. They make them tanner, skinner, bigger in certain spots, and they make there skin look perfect. In reality no one is perfect so you have to understand that all of that is done from a computer. For women and girls all around the world this sends and image of the "perfect" person. It tells us that in order to be accepted in society we need to look like that everyday. These images make women feel like they need to starve themselves to be skinny or receive plastic surgery to get rid of wrinkles. Most women are already insecure about there bodies and magazines and books make it worse.
